Williamstown Township is excited to announce that award winning artist Bobbi Kilty will return to join the 12th Annual Artists’ Fine Art Sale & Studio Tour May 5th and 6th, 2023. Bobbi Kilty is a local artist who draws inspiration from nature and ecology. Using a wide variety of mediums, she celebrates the environment around her, whether it be in her own backyard in Williamston, Japan, or Europe.

Bobbi enjoys working with new materials and techniques, experimenting and exploring possibilities within the realm of art. She has recently been trying new capabilities of house paint, spackle, diazo paper, cheese cloth, comic book imagery, pigmented inks, Fosshape fabric, and Zen brushwork on rice paper. The latter fosters coordination of mind, body and brush while in a “no-mind” state and relates strongly to the art of dance. She is a painter in encaustic and combined media, which uses a durable and versatile wax-based paint that can be melted down and spread over a surface.

Born in Tampa, Florida, Bobbi has been drawing since the age of 5. As a child she lived in Pennsylvania, Texas, Wisconsin and Illinois. As an undergraduate in the Art Department at Northwestern University, she majored first in visual arts and then shifted emphasis to Interior Design to maximize potential in the work place. After completing an M.F.A. degree at UCLA, she began her teaching career at Washington State University. In 1973 she studied Sumie (contemporary Japanese brush painting) at Osaka University, Japan. Courses she has taught include architectural illustration, perspective and mixed media rendering, color theory, barrier free design and even ergonomics. While at Michigan State University, she drew and painted her way from Ireland to Italy as she led students in the Interior Design Study Abroad program. After serving four years as the MSU Interior Design Program Director, she is now living the dream!
